What are the Qualifications?
Customer service experience and experience with seniors desired
Dementia care experience is preferred
Must undergo a Physical exam and Tuberculosis Screening, resulting in a negative TB diagnosis prior to employment
Must obtain clearance or exemption approval from the Department of Social Services following FBI and DOJ livescan background check prior to employment
Must read, understand and sign the Report of Suspected Physical Abuse of a Dependent Elder (SOC341A)

What Will I Be Doing?
Assist the Director of Life Enrichment in administrative tasks as well as planning, organizing, and facilitating daily activities, special events and outings for residents
Set up and prepare activity areas, ensuring all necessary materials and equipment are available
Engage residents in a variety of activities, including games, arts and crafts, exercise programs, and outings. Encourage participation and support residents in their engagement with activities, adapting as needed to meet individual preferences and abilities. Maintain a positive and friendly demeanor, fostering a welcoming environment for all residents. Provide exceptional hospitality and professionalism in all interactions
Participate and lead social events, outings, and other destinations according to a scheduled itinerary. Assist with transportation and mobility needs of residents during activities. Assist residents with entering and exiting vehicles safely and respectfully
Ensure the safety and well-being of residents during all activities, reporting any concerns and changes in resident behavior to the Director of Life Enrichment
